Design features

The main difference between combined equipment and solid fuel equipment is the presence of a thermoelectric heater in the heat exchanger tank. The heating element turns on automatically at the moment when the power of the combusted fuel is not enough to ensure the optimum temperature of the coolant. In other words, the heating element starts up when firewood or coal burns out, the heat subsides and there is a need to heat the coolant. All processes are fully automated and do not require human intervention, with the exception, perhaps, of laying firewood in the firebox.

In order to quickly and efficiently heat up the premises, different boilers have from 1 to 4 combustion chambers, each of which is connected to a separate thermoelectric heater.

The boiler for heating a private house combined wood / electricity has only 1 combustion chamber and 1 thermoelectric heater, and the water is heated by analogy with a storage water heater (boiler).

Why buy

  • A wide range of fuels used - it can be not only coal or firewood, but also briquettes, pellets, wood waste, etc.;
  • Autonomous operation - the combined boiler in the "electricity" mode works for an unlimited amount of time without human intervention. The restriction in heating can only be due to the lack of electricity. The operation of the equipment is absolutely safe;
  • Convenient maintenance - if necessary, the boiler can be converted into mono-fuel. When using a predominantly electric mode, cleaning of the boiler and chimney is not required; with regular use of solid fuel, it is necessary to clean the boiler as often as a standard solid fuel boiler - once a week the furnace and 1 time in 3-5 months the chimney.

Price is hard to include as an advantage. Compared to mono-fuel boilers, combined boilers are much more expensive, depending on the brand and the number of combustion chambers.

Installation Features

Combined equipment will require a separate room. Here it is necessary to provide the following mandatory installation elements:

  • foundation - a low reinforced concrete layer that compensates for the dimensions of the boiler;
  • arrangement of the chimney - the principle is in many respects similar to the chimney on a solid fuel boiler, where high-quality draft is provided

Photo 4 Plan-scheme of the heating system for a combined boiler

The traction power depends on the height of the pipe head. Its optimal height above the ridge is from 50 cm.

Once the boiler has been installed, the chimney must be carefully insulated. This will avoid the appearance of condensate and ice in the pipe, which prevents smoke from escaping.

  • a ventilation system that will allow timely removal of combustion products and carbon monoxide when it appears.
  • connection to the mains - a heating element that maintains and heats the coolant to a certain temperature, operates exclusively from the mains 220 volts.

To connect the equipment, a 380 volt line and 3 phases is required. In this case, it is necessary to ensure the correct connection of the input and grounding to the circuit. You should not take risks and make grounding to zero a simple break in the circuit, the automation simply will not have time to do the skew.

Principle of operation

The principle of operation of a combined heating boiler is quite simple. The heat generator, powered by the mains, starts the electric heater. Pipe electric heaters begin to heat the coolant (water) in automatic mode according to the principle of a boiler. This process is automated by a special device, only firewood is loaded into the firebox manually.

While the heater is heating the water, you need to fill the combustion chamber with firewood and set it on fire. The combustion chamber is located below and transfers heat from burning firewood to the heat exchanger. When the temperature of the coolant reaches a predetermined level, the heating element turns off, and then only firewood generates heat. The burning power of firewood can reach 30 kW, which is enough to heat the house.

Combination boiler operation

When the firewood burns out, the heating element turns on again and maintains the set temperature. You can only heat with firewood, and turn on the heating element only for safety. If firewood runs out, then only the heating element will provide heat. But often electricity and firewood are used simultaneously, this is especially convenient at night, when it is not possible to constantly put firewood in the firebox. Then firewood is laid in the evening, and the heating element is turned on to maintain heat not at full capacity.

If electricity is used as a priority for heating, and firewood is used only as a reserve, then boiler maintenance is simplified to a minimum. The desired temperature is set automatically and the heating element is responsible for maintaining it. When the electricity is turned off, as is often the case in our country, you put firewood in the furnace, and the boiler starts to work on solid fuel.

Important. When operating the boiler on wood, make sure that the damper on the chimney is open. When working on electricity, the valve can be closed.

Flaws

And yet, with all the advantages, combined boilers have their drawbacks, like any other heating equipment.


It is better to install the combined boiler on a pre-strengthened base
  1. It is necessary to equip a separate room - a boiler room, it is also necessary to store fuel reserves.
  2. Weight. Devices made of cast iron can weigh several hundred kilograms; before installing such a boiler, a concrete pad may be required to reinforce the subfloor. Due to the significant weight of the product, there are no models for wall mounting, only models for floor mounting.
  3. The design of combined boilers is more complex, which affects the cost of installation and service repairs.
  4. Another disadvantage is the low power of the electrical component. The power of electric heaters should not exceed the power of the wood burning chamber. The power range of a wood-burning firebox is within 6 - 25 kW.
  5. The cost of models of combined boilers is 20-40% more expensive than similar solid fuel boilers, but their purchase is much more justified than installing one type of boiler and then replacing it with another.

Features of boilers for wood and electricity

A traditional solid fuel boiler is a wood-burning stove with a built-in heat exchanger that provides the heating system with a hot coolant. Firewood is placed in its firebox, burning merrily and generating thermal energy absorbed by the coil. And in order for the house to always be warm, it is necessary to throw all new logs into the firebox - even at night. That is, instead of sleeping, you will have to get up and stomp to the insatiable unit.

Wood-fired heating boilers cause inconvenience even during the day. The logs in them burn out very quickly. If you do not follow the level of the flame, the heating will cool down, the house will become noticeably cooler. This problem is solved in the following ways:

  • Purchase of pyrolysis units and models with large fireboxes;
  • Purchase of pellet boilers with automatic fuel supply;
  • Installation of a boiler that runs on wood and electricity.

The last option is the cheapest. Pyrolysis units are complex and expensive, the same drawbacks are inherent in pellet samples. But boilers and stoves on wood and electricity have an affordable price.

An electric wood-burning boiler is a conventional solid fuel appliance that runs on wood. But as soon as the firewood in its interior runs out, and the temperature of the coolant drops below a predetermined level, the heating element (or several heating elements at once) is turned on. It maintains the temperature in the circuit, preventing it from cooling down quickly.

Heating elements are responsible precisely for maintaining the temperature, they are not able to warm houses only due to their power. They also allow a gradual cooling of the coolant, but they are enough for several hours.

Temperature control can be built-in or external - some models are equipped with built-in thermostats.

Solid fuel combined boilers are equipped with one or two heating elements of limited power. Single-phase and three-phase networks (more often single-phase) act as a power source for them.

Boiler operation

A solid fuel boiler in general is a compact metal furnace equipped with a fuel combustion chamber, a heat exchanger, a smoke exhaust system and a door for regulating the air supply. The built-in electric heater is located below the grate and is connected if necessary.

During fuel combustion, when the temperature of the water in the heat exchanger drops, the heating element heats it up until the solid fuel ignites again. This mode reduces the load on the heating circuits, and in open systems maintains constant circulation. The combustion of solid fuels is a process that cannot be fine-tuned and cannot be automatically stopped, therefore, at night, the operation of such equipment must be stopped. The use of electric heaters allows you to extinguish the boilers at night, while maintaining the desired temperature. Electric heating is not used as the main source of heat, since this is not beneficial in combined-type boilers; there are other types of equipment for these purposes.

Solid fuel boilers can only be used if there is a constant circulation, that is, either the heating system is built on the principle of natural circulation, or the circulation pumps are connected to an uninterruptible power supply. This is necessary because the burning of firewood cannot be stopped automatically and instantly, and if the pumps stop, the water will boil while burning continues, and the heating system will be seriously damaged.
